Mayasheel Retail India Limited Vs State Of Chhattisgarh (Chhattisgarh High Court)
The Hon’ble Chhattisgarh High Court in Mayasheel Retail India Ltd. v. State of Chhattisgarh [Writ Petition No. 84 of 2024 dated April 04, 2025] dismissed the writ petition where the Assessee had challenged demand order on ground that it came to Assessee’s knowledge pursuant to issuance of recovery notice.
